The applicant will join the Caltech SPHEREx team as a research scientist. The applicant will join and extensively collaborate with the SPHEREx Science Team in its preparation for the scientific interpretation of the SPHEREx mission data. It is expected the candidate will become a full SPHEREx Science Team member by the time of launch and will fully participate in the core science programs. Details about the SPHEREx mission can be found here https://spherex.caltech.edu.
The applicant will contribute to the development of the high-level cosmological analysis, i.e. the scientific analysis required to reach SPHEREx science objectives given a spectroscopic galaxy catalog. It will include when necessary methodology and theoretical development. This work will require extensive software development. Prior experience in redshift measurements using photometric surveys, clustering measurements, higher-order statistics, mitigation of systematic effects, pipeline validation using cosmological simulations, or pipeline development and management will be particularly valued.
Applicants must have a Ph.D. or equivalent and a strong track record of original research in large-scale structure cosmology. The appointment is expected to be renewed as long as the SPHEREx mission continues (the end of nominal mission is currently scheduled in 2028) contingent on successful performance.
